Motorola Edge 50 Pro to Launch in India; Teased to Get 144Hz Display, 50-Megapixel Camera

The Lenovo-owned brand announced on Monday (March 18) that the Motorola Edge 50 Pro will soon launch in India. Flipkart’s dedicated microsite revealed some designs and specifications of the Edge series smartphones ahead of their launch. The Motorola Edge 50 Pro features a curved pOLED display with a 144Hz refresh rate and is available in at least three color options. This is ensured by an AI-supported camera unit with a 50-megapixel main sensor. The Motorola Edge 50 Pro is expected to come with the third-generation Snapdragon 8 chip.

In a post on X, Motorola India has announced that the Motorola Edge 50 Pro will be launching in India soon. It has been confirmed to be sold via Flipkart. The teaser shows the phone with a curved screen and a waterdrop notch in the center of the display that houses the selfie camera. However, Motorola did not reveal the exact release date of the next smartphone.

As mentioned earlier, the Flipkart website has a landing page that showcases the design and specifications of the Motorola Edge 50 Pro. It is confirmed to be available in Black, Purple and White hues. The phone features a 6.7-inch POLED display that supports 1.5K resolution, 144Hz refresh rate, and 2000 nits maximum brightness. This display is HDR10+ certified and covers 100% of the DCI-P3 color spectrum. The screen features SGS eye protection and a Corning Gorilla Glass 5 coating to reduce blue light emission.

The Motorola Edge 50 Pro has been confirmed to feature an under-display optical fingerprint scanner. The upcoming phone is said to be the world’s first Pantone certified camera. It features an AI-powered triple rear camera setup that includes a 50-megapixel primary camera with 2μm AI, an ultra-wide-angle camera with 50x hybrid zoom, and a 10-megapixel telephoto lens.

According to the previously leaked information, the Motorola Edge 50 Pro will come with a 3rd generation Snapdragon 8s chip with 12GB of RAM. The phone is set to officially launch on April 3 alongside the Motorola Edge 50 Fusion.
